Scope of the project:

Until now, the robot which provide service such as washing stairs, walls and swimming pool are developing
continually but the cleaning robot for the beach does not be much interest. This project is based on
garbage collection on the beach using wireless communication. The robot will be applicable on both type
of sand that is dry and wet. We will use a mechanism which will allow the robot to pick up the trash
continuously and precisely as it can, so there will be much clean environment. In addition, there will be a
solar panel attached on the robot for the rechargeable batteries. The RC robot can be work within 800-
1000m range.

Literature Review:

Modular robot used as a beach cleaner: In this paper author discussed about an autonomous system
which is based on optical flow algorithms and speed control of the motor. This system is used for detecting
cans on the beach and following through Optical flow algorithms, the system is then capable for holding
cans and then pushed it into the dumpster. Firstly infrared depth sensors are used to detect any obstacles,
which are further integrated to the 3D camera. Both RGB and HSV images are used to detect the cans in
the image. The obtained images are converted to binary data, allowing binary operations with low
computational cost. Then, a noise rejection filter is applied in both RGB and HSV samples. Mabuchi LC-
578VA Automotive Power Window Lifter motors were chosen. Due to a large internal mechanical gear
reduction, this motor presents high torque with relatively small packing. [1]

Garbage Collection Robot on the Beach using Wireless Communications: The author introduced a system
which is manually controlled by the user. A wireless IP camera is used for the detection of images, after
the images are taken theses are sent to the computer via Ad hoc and the image is displayed by the IP
camera tool software. Microsoft Visual Basic 2005 is used for the controlling of robot. Optoisolator is used
to pass the signal from the microcontroller to drive the gate of the
RFP50N (power MOSFET) that is used to drive the motor at 12Vdc. Forty watts of solar cell is used to
charge the battery. [2]
Prometeo Beach Cleaner Robot: In this paper author discusses about the autonomous system. The System
starts with a 3D camera, it sends the images by USB port to an embedded computer who processes all the
System’s algorithms. The acquired images are processed by a Stereoscopic Vision Algorithm and an object
recognition algorithm. This both algorithms allow the robot define the scenario limits, found and
recognize the objects in the working area and calculate the relative position of the objects to the robot.
The Vision System had been developed using the OPEN CV libraries. With the scenario limits and the
objects positions, the robot formulates a task or verifies a previous one. A task could be: collecting cans
or leaving them in the dumpster if it has been found before, else the robot will begin the task of searching.

Current State of Art:

According to the literature review and the knowledge from the current situation, system are getting more
complex and efficient. The beach cleaning robot are going towards more advancement and these types
of robot are capable for taking data through sensor if they find any obstacles and send data to the user
through Bluetooth or RC based on Internet of things (IOT). The second technology which got implemented
on the system is that it works autonomously, the robot will find any obstacle by itself through image
processing or built in program. These program allow the robot to move or follow on one track and gets
back to its origin.
